Bundesliga Report: Bayern Munich v Hoffenheim 05 October 2019

Robert Lewandowski

Bundesliga

Result: Bayern Munich 1-2 Hoffenheim

Date: 05 October 2019

Venue: Allianz Stadium

Bayern Munich suffered their first loss of the 2019/20 Bundesliga campaign after going down 2-1 to Hoffenheim at Allianz Arena on Saturday afternoon.   The Bavarians' thumping win over Tottenham Hotspur in the UEFA Champions League came with a casualty, as David Alaba got injured and tactically, Thiago Alcantara replaced him in the line-up against Hoffenheim as the only change to partner Corentin Tolisso in midfield, while Benjamin Pavard switched to left-back and Joshua Kimmich withdrawn to right-back.   Bayern had a slow start but they almost went ahead in the 24th minute after Serge Gnabry slotted home a cross from Kimmich inside the box but the goal was disallowed for offside in the build-up.   Hoffenheim were threatening on counter-attacks and they nearly broke the deadlock in the 33rd minute after Ihlas Bebou broke away on the left channel but his curling shot was saved by goalkeeper Manuel Neuer.   Niko Kovac's charges were increasing their intensity in the latter phase of the first stanza, coming close to finding the breakthrough but they were not clinical enough as the first stanza ended without goals.   The game was opening up in the early stages of the second stanza and Hoffenheim broke the deadlock nine minutes inside the second stanza thanks to Adamyan, who a struck a low shot past Neuer after the visitors forced Bayern into an error high up the pitch, 0-1.   Bayern rallied and found the equaliser in the 73rd minute courtesy of Robert Lewandowoski, who guided a shot in the centre of the six-yard box to the back of the net, following a pin-point cross from Thomas Muller, 1-1.   However, Adamyan restored the lead for Hoffeheim with 11 minutes remaining after firing another low shot from the edge of the box past the hand of Neuer against the run of play and got his brace in the process.   The Bavarians were surging forward in numbers, in the closing stages searching for the equaliser but they unable to carve out an opening  as Hoffenheim held for three points.
